Position Overview
We are looking for a Knowledge Manager with experience in INDOPACOM to join our team. Responsibilities Primarily be responsible for managing incoming requirements, ensuring task guidance is clear, communicating to the team responsible for completing the task, and tracking metrics. Be readily available to shift focus to fulfill emerging client requests. Demonstrate attention to detail, flexibility, communication skills, understanding of the client mission, and problem solving. Ability to brief and engage Senior Executives and Senior Military Officers on requirements and mission updates. Use discussions and workshops with leadership and teammates to identify and innovate the elements that work best in their environment and areas for improvement.
Required Qualifications
Experience working in the DoD. Experience engaging with senior government and military officials. Experience developing strategic communications plans. Experience using Microsoft Office Suite. Education/experience combinations: HS diploma or GED with 6+ years in intelligence; Associate's degree with 4+ years in intelligence; or Bachelor's degree with 2+ years in intelligence. Active TS/SCI clearance required; willingness to take a polygraph exam.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ience working in the intelligence community (IC). Experience as an executive assistant, executive officer, and requirements manager. Knowledge of COLISEUM. Knowledge of the EUCOM AOR. Ability to provide shift work support, if required. Active TS/SCI with CI polygraph.
